$100m allocated for district development plans

KABUL): The Ministry of Rural Rehabilitation and Development had allocated $100 million (4.539 billion afghanis) for the implementation of development projects during the ongoing year, the minister said on Sunday.

The amount had been specified for the construction of roads, bridges, water supply systems, electricity and other infrastructure development projects, Rural Rehabilitation and Development Minister, Jarullah Mansuri, told Pajhwok Afghan News at the end of a two-day national conference participated by district council heads in Kabul.

Over the past eight years, he said, $126 million had been spent on projects in districts. The minister said this year’s budget for the same would be high compared to the previous years.

Mansuri also said public representatives at the conference floated their suggestions and called for the continuation of infrastructure development projects in districts.
